Using Doubles to Subtract Printable Pack
Math, Addition and Subtraction, Subtraction, Preschool, Grade 1, Worksheets & Printables, Worksheets
Have your students just started learning about using doubles to subtract? Have they mastered the skill? Do you have students in your classroom who could use additional practice to sharpen their subtraction skills? This is aUsing Doubles to Subtract Printable Packfor your lower elementary students. If your students are fluent with their doubles facts, this is a subtraction strategy for you! One strategy of many, of course, but one more tool your students can use to master their basic addition and subtraction facts. There are 3 pages included. The first page will provide a detailed visual for solving subtraction problems with this strategy. At the bottom of the page, students will be given practice problems. On the second page, students will have 30 doubles additions facts to solve. On the third page, students will use what they know about adding doubles to help you subtract. There are 20 subtraction problems on the final page. These pages can be completed as a whole group, small group, or in centers . I hope you enjoy! Text Types - 9 x A3 Posters PLUS 18 x Activity Sheets
ELA, Reading, Grammar, Not Grade Specific, Worksheets & Printables, Worksheets
Text Types - 9 x A3 Posters PLUS 18 x Activity Sheets is a versatile teaching resource that supports building students' understanding of different text structures. This set includes nine large A3 posters illustrating key text types - description, discussion, explanation, exposition, information report, narrative, procedure, recount, and response. Each poster provides a student-friendly definition and visual example. Also included are 18 supplementary activity sheets that allow educators to extend learning through targeted skill practice. Whether used for whole-class instruction, small group work, or independent practice, this comprehensive text types resource equips students to recognize and apply various text structures. The posters visually engage learners while the activity sheets reinforce identification and usage of text types. Suitable for Language Arts classrooms or literacy centers , this resource helps establish solid genre knowledge.
